      That is actually a very good question – I am not sure. I know that the solar system was formed from a giant disk of dust called an accretion disk. Over millions of years, particles in this disk clumped together to form the sun and the planets. I am not sure why exactly the different planets formed as they did – this could be something for you to look into further!
